#f45461 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f45461 is composed of 95.7% red, 32.9% green and 38%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 65.6% magenta, 60.2%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 355.1 degrees, a saturation of 87.9% and a lightness of 64.3%. #f45461 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a8c2 with #e90000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6666.

Shades and Tints of #f45461

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0102 is the darkest color, while #fffafa is the lightest one.

Tones of #f45461

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a7a1a1 is the less saturated color, while #fb4d5b is the most saturated one.
